Overview
Amazon is hiring an Operations Manager for the AMXL team to lead the transformation of Japan's furniture and home appliance delivery network. You'll integrate local delivery company networks with Amazon technology to build a new national delivery network.
Job Description
Who you are
You have a strong background in operations management, ideally with experience in logistics or supply chain. You are passionate about improving delivery quality and building strong relationships with partners. You understand the importance of integrating technology with operations to enhance efficiency and customer satisfaction.
You possess excellent communication skills, allowing you to effectively collaborate with various stakeholders, including delivery partners and internal teams. Your analytical mindset helps you manage operational metrics and drive improvements in service quality and compliance.
What you'll do
As an Operations Manager at Amazon, you will oversee the operations metrics of partner delivery companies, ensuring that delivery quality is consistently improved. You will work closely with local delivery networks to integrate their operations with Amazon's technology, creating a seamless national delivery network.
Your role will involve strengthening trust and collaboration with partners while ensuring compliance with safety regulations and operational standards. You will be responsible for identifying opportunities for service enhancements and implementing strategies to achieve operational excellence.
